Purpose of role

The Staff Physical Design Engineer is expected to work as part of a Physical implementation design team. Within the team, the designer will have responsibility for block development and possibly full chip responsibility from RTL to GDS and will be expected to be diligent in their ownership of the responsibilities assigned to them. They will also be able to manage a team of 2-3 engineers of lower grade and be responsible for their line management and, if appropriate, day-to-day tasks.

Skills & experience

  • Typically, 5+ years’ experience.
  • Should have good tapeout experience on multiple technologies 3nm, 5nm, 7nm, 12nm, 16nm, 22nm, 28nm.
  • Should have worked on the DRC, LVS, ANTENNA, ERC physical verification checks.
  • Should have good work experience and understanding of concepts in Synthesis, Floorplanning, Placement, CTS, Routing, STA.
  • Input skill set one or more of the following: PnR using either Synopsys ICC, Cadence EDI, Mentor Olympus, Synthesis using either Synopsys DC or Cadence RC, Experience of Formality or Formalpro, Experience of Mentor Calibre or Synopsys IC Validator.
